Ride To Eat - FarRide #7 MOREE NSW - 17th May 2008
This will be of interest to those who like to take a "longer ride" with the ride being the focus not the coffee breaks. Most Ride to Eat FarRides will be planned at 1000k minimum days. This is not a group ride, there is no route to follow. Be at the Destination at the time stated and be able to complete 1000klm within a 24hr period. That is the purpose of FarRiders.
It is not of Iron Butt proportions (just yet) but its aimed at those who are after a good long days ride and to meet, although briefly, with fellow riders with the same mindset. The entry level IBA ride is called a SaddleSore 1600k which is 1600k under 24hrs IBA
The idea is to try for a minimum 500 klm ride to the food and drinks. 1000klm min for the day

I have been asked where the name came from, FarRide. I watched a movie recently called Hidalgo.
Frank was called "Far Rider" in that movie and I liked the term when related to endurance riding.
